The Concord housing market is currently classified as a strong seller's market with a median sale price of $395,000. Prices have risen 4.0% compared to last year, with homes spending an average of 32 days on market, indicating 1.4 months of inventory.With limited inventory, homes sell quickly and buyers should be prepared to act decisively and competitively to secure a property.
